Who We Are

Welcome to e-STORAGE, a proud member of the Canadian Solar Inc. (NASDAQ: CSIQ) family! We’re leading the way in designing, building, and integrating advanced battery energy storage systems for utility-scale projects. Our mission? To accelerate the world’s renewable energy transition and create a more sustainable, resilient energy future for everyone.

With our innovative SolBank lithium-iron phosphate battery technology and comprehensive project services, we’re not just building products we’re powering communities and making a difference worldwide.

About the Role:

We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Cyber Security Lead to join our team and contribute to the development of on-premises Energy Management System (EMS) for utility grade systems.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in cybersecurity for industrial control systems, a passion for sustainable energy, and the ability to work collaboratively in a dynamic startup-like environment. 

 

As  Cybersecurity Lead for EQ-S, you will play a pivotal role in ensuring the security and compliance of our leading-edge EMS platforms, which drives energy solution digitalization, system performance analytics, and grid energy management systems. You will lead the integration of security features into the software lifecycle, perform risk assessments, and ensure compliance with industry standards such as NERC-CIP, IEC 62443, and other regional regulations. Your expertise will be critical in securing the energy management and data analytics software against evolving threats while aligning with industry standards.  

 

The ideal candidate will possess a strong background in cybersecurity for software-based energy management systems, distributed networking, and IoT devices. You will be responsible for analyzing regulatory requirements, programming security features, and ensuring the successful delivery of secure and compliant solutions. 

We are looking for a hands-on cybersecurity engineer who is passionate about securing energy systems, stays current with evolving cyber threats and technologies, challenges conventional approaches, and drives continuous improvement across products, projects, and processes. 


Responsibilities:

Cybersecurity Strategy & Risk Management 

  • Apply Cyber-Informed Engineering (CIE) principles to conduct cybersecurity risk assessments for EQ-EMS, SCADA systems, BESS installations, and related energy infrastructure. 

  • Define and drive the cybersecurity roadmap for EQ-S, aligning security initiatives with business objectives, customer requirements, and industry best practices. 

  • Establish and maintain secure-by-design development practices, ensuring cybersecurity controls are integrated throughout the product lifecycle. 

  • Perform threat modeling, vulnerability assessments, and security reviews to identify and mitigate cybersecurity risks. 

Product & Customer Engagement 

  • Collaborate with Product Management and Engineering teams to define cybersecurity requirements and acceptance criteria for product features and releases. 

  • Act as the primary cybersecurity subject matter expert for customers, EPCs, utilities, consultants, and internal stakeholders. 

  • Support sales, proposal, and project deployment activities by developing compliant cybersecurity solutions for customer requirements. 

  • Review customer specifications and provide technical guidance on cybersecurity architectures and implementation approaches for utility-scale projects. 

Security Architecture & Engineering 

  • Design, develop, and validate cybersecurity solutions and tooling for energy management systems, including:  

  • Intrusion Detection and Prevention Systems (IDS/IPS) 

  • Network monitoring and visibility solutions 

  • Security dashboards and reporting 

  • Vulnerability management and scanning tools 

  • Security automation and continuous monitoring capabilities 

  • Log collection, analysis, and SIEM integrations 

  • Develop cybersecurity requirements, specifications, test plans, and validation procedures for new products and features. 

  • Design and maintain secure reference architectures for utility-scale energy projects, including:  

  • Network segmentation strategies, DMZ architectures 

  • Firewall policy design and management; Secure remote access solutions  

  • Identity and access management; Encryption and key management solutions

  • Secure communications using TLS, MQTT, OPC UA, and related technologies 

Cybersecurity Standards & Industry Requirements 

  • Interpret and implement cybersecurity requirements from standards and frameworks including:  

  • IEC 62443, NERC CIP, NIST Cybersecurity Framework, ISO 27001

  • Utility and regional cybersecurity requirements 

  • Develop cybersecurity design guidelines, security hardening standards, and implementation best practices for product and project teams. 

  • Lead cybersecurity gap assessments and ensure security requirements are incorporated into product and project deliverables. 

  • Collaborate with internal teams to support customer cybersecurity questionnaires, audits, and security reviews. 

Incident Response & Operational Security 

  • Develop and maintain incident response plans, security monitoring processes, and cybersecurity operational procedures. 

  • Support investigation and remediation of cybersecurity vulnerabilities and incidents. 

  • Monitor emerging cybersecurity threats, vulnerabilities, and industry trends, ensuring timely updates to products, architectures, and security practices. 

  • Drive continuous improvement of security monitoring, threat detection, and response capabilities across the EQ-S platform. 

Training & Security Culture 

  • Develop cybersecurity awareness programs and technical training materials for engineering, deployment, and operations teams. 

  • Promote cybersecurity best practices across the organization and foster a security-first culture. 

  • Mentor engineers and technical teams on cybersecurity principles, secure development practices, and industry standards.

Required Qualifications and Skills: 

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Cybersecurity,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Software Engineering, Information Technology, or a related discipline. 

  • 7+ years of experience in cybersecurity roles supporting industrial control systems (ICS), operational technology (OT), critical infrastructure, or energy systems. 

  • Strong knowledge of cybersecurity frameworks and standards including: IEC 62443 (including 2-1, 3-2, 4-1, and 4-2), NERC CIP, NIST Cybersecurity Framework, ISO 27001

  • Experience working with utility-scale energy systems, including EMS, SCADA, BMS, BESS, PCS/Inverters, Solar PV, and hybrid energy systems. 

  • Strong understanding of OT networking architectures and cybersecurity controls. 

  • Hands-on experience with industrial communication protocols including:  Modbus TCP/IP, DNP3, IEC 61850, MQTT, OPC UA  

  • Experience implementing cybersecurity controls such as:  Network segmentation, DMZ architectures, Firewalls, Jump servers and proxy servers, IDS/IPS solutions, Secure remote access technologies 

  • Experience with vulnerability management, penetration testing, threat modeling, encryption technologies, PKI, secure communications, and key management. 

  • Proficiency with scripting and automation using Python and familiarity with TypeScript, JavaScript, Go, Java, C++, or similar languages. 

  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and troubleshooting abilities. 

  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to communicate complex cybersecurity concepts to both technical and non-technical audiences. 

  • Ability to work independently while collaborating effectively across global, cross-functional teams. 

 

 Preferred Experience:  

  • Experience designing and securing utility-scale EMS, SCADA, and distributed energy resource management systems. 

  • Experience with hybrid on-premises and cloud-based architectures in regulated critical infrastructure environments. 

  • Hands-on experience with cybersecurity monitoring platforms, endpoint security tools, SIEM technologies, and security analytics. 

  • Familiarity with utility interconnection requirements, grid operator cybersecurity requirements, and customer security standards for energy projects. 

  • Cybersecurity certifications such as IC32M, CISSP, GICSP, IEC 62443 Cybersecurity Expert, GRID, CISA, Security+, or equivalent. 

  • Experience leading cybersecurity initiatives, architecture reviews, and cross-functional security programs in complex industrial environments. 

  • Experience supporting third-party cybersecurity assessments, customer security evaluations, and certification initiatives.
